Well, that’s when the powers of essential oils come in – their wondrous therapeutic properties have been known for many centuries and are still applied to modern day uses.
Both Early to Bed and Early to Rise shower gels contain specific fruit and herbal extracts that are meant to help and enhance one’s mood. With their Early to Bed shower gel the calming and soothing properties of Clove and Ylang Ylang are carefully blended with the stress-relieving quality of Lavender to put you in a relaxing and peaceful state of mind – something quite important to a good night’s sleep. When I opened the bottle cap the first scents that hit me were Clove and Ylang Ylang. Both have very powerful aromas that immediately brings tranquility to the mind. Some may not appreciate their pungent scents but I’ve been using natural essential oils and extracts for many years so I was accustomed to their fragrances. The lavender is very light but it’s in there and if you take a careful whiff, you’ll enjoy the melange of scents that is altogether soothing and intriguing. Although I can’t quite say whether it had helped me fall asleep faster than if I didn’t use it, the shower gel did create a natural sense of tranquility.
With the Early to Rise shower gel I was eager to try that right away. Using the essential extracts of Wild Mint and Citrus such as lemon and grapefruit, the fresh scents are both refreshing and invigorating. I definitely felt more awake the instant I stepped into the shower and poured some of the Early to Rise shower gel into my palms. I’m a major fan of citrus in my shower gels as they are delightful to the senses and reminds me of orchards and meadows.
Kiss My Face uses naturally derived ingredients and do not contain parabens, phthalates, or SLS and are generally gentle on the skin. They do not use any artificial fragrances only essential oils and extracts and come in a variety of delightful scents. We’ve been using Kiss My Face products for many years and I even use their kids formulas for my son. I really like the fact that they harness the powers of essential extracts to use for therapeutic purposes as well as enhances one’s mood. The properties for the two shower gels contain the following:
Early to Bed Shower Gel –
Chamomile – calms and soothes the skin
Ylang Ylang – soothing for the body and mind
Olive Oil – superb moisturizer for all skin types
Early to Rise Shower Gel –
Basil – stimulates skin circulation
Lemon – uplifting and refreshing for the skin
Olive Oil – superb moisturizer for all skin types
